Ever wondered why some metals sit quietly… while others explode into colour the moment they touch water? In this lesson, we dive into Group 1: the Alkali Metals — the most reactive family on the periodic table.
These are not your average metals. They fizz, they race, and sometimes they ignite in spectacular flames. But beneath the drama is a set of clear rules that examiners love to test.
We start by exploring what makes alkali metals so different from metals like iron. You’ll see why they’re soft enough to cut with a knife, why some of them float on water, and why their flame colours are so distinctive.
Then we move into their reactions — with oxygen, water, acids, and even halogens — breaking each one down so it actually makes sense rather than feeling like something to memorise.
The most important part comes when we answer the big question students struggle with: Why does reactivity increase as you go down Group 1? Using clear atomic models and visual shielding explanations, we show exactly what’s happening inside the atom and why losing that outer electron becomes easier and more dangerous lower down the group.
This is where many students have an “ohhh” moment — and where grades start to improve.
You’ll also tackle common exam traps, including:
• Why melting points decrease down Group 1
• How this trend is the opposite of halogens
• How to predict reactions you’ve never seen before The lesson finishes with a quick exam-style challenge to test your understanding and lock the ideas in.
